[技术问答] Keil与IAR对新唐MCU的支持差异体现在哪些方面?

[复制链接]
2160|34
dspmana 发表于 2025-12-17 22:21 | 显示全部楼层
IAR 用户可直接下载例程,打开即可编译运行,无需修改任何配置
albertaabbot 发表于 2025-12-18 08:54 | 显示全部楼层
库文件链接方式              
旧巷情人 发表于 2025-12-18 11:01 | 显示全部楼层
Keil 与 IAR 对新唐 MCU 的支持差异:Keil MDK-ARM 基于 ARM 官方 CMSIS,对新唐 M0/M4 系列外设库适配更原生,调试时与 ULINK 仿真器联动更优;IAR EWARM 对新唐高端 M7 系列支持更及时,编译效率更高,且跨平台性好,对新唐低功耗系列的功耗调试工具集成更完善。
youtome 发表于 2025-12-18 17:19 | 显示全部楼层
追求简洁界面与清晰代码结构,IAR 是较优选择。
adolphcocker 发表于 2025-12-18 19:41 | 显示全部楼层
IAR的编译器能生成更紧凑的代码,尤其适合资源受限的项目。
sanfuzi 发表于 2025-12-18 23:00 | 显示全部楼层
Keil图形化界面友好,适合新手。
saservice 发表于 2025-12-19 12:27 | 显示全部楼层
优先选择 Keil               
chenci2013 发表于 2025-12-19 13:04 | 显示全部楼层
GCC + VS Code + PlatformIO 开源方案
gygp 发表于 2025-12-19 13:41 | 显示全部楼层
IAR 是新唐的 “嫡系”,Keil 是 “通用适配”
primojones 发表于 2025-12-19 14:47 | 显示全部楼层
若项目涉及 C++高级特性 或需要多个工程协同管理,则 Keil MDK 更具优势。
maqianqu 发表于 2025-12-19 15:43 | 显示全部楼层
IAR以其优秀的优化编译器而闻名,能够提供更高效的代码生成。
olivem55arlowe 发表于 2025-12-20 21:32 | 显示全部楼层
Keil通过 Pack Installer 管理,官方支持,更新及时
xiaoyaodz 发表于 2025-12-20 22:39 | 显示全部楼层
工程结构管理              
belindagraham 发表于 2025-12-21 14:57 | 显示全部楼层
Keil:采用Arm Compiler 5/6,支持现代化C/C++标准。其新一代编译器在代码密度和运行效率上较传统AC5有显著提升。
IAR:以极致优化著称,其专有编译器通过深度指令调度和寄存器分配算法,可生成比GCC小10~30%的代码体积,尤其适合资源受限的M0/M0+核MCU
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 在线客服 返回列表 返回顶部
0